My friend’s compulsion toward addictive behavior has reared its ugly head for the second time in her lifetime. She is in recovery, and her healing comes with pain as she does the intense work of self-examination and making amends. In assuring her that we have chosen to take this journey at her side, our mutual friends and I are made keenly aware that many in recovery suffer lives torn apart as they lose the love and support so important to them. I dedicate this post to those of us who make and keep the commitment to stay together, and I invoke two songs whose interplay better describes our conviction than any essay could. 

In context, “Stand” may at first seem to be a prayerful benediction directed to the person in recovery. From my perspective, it is also a statement of commitment from those of us in support of our friend or loved one in recovery. We stand, we stay, we are not going away, and while we honor restraints on our involvement, we still want our friends and loved ones to see us as a presence, a shoulder, a prayer partner.

And why do we stand?  Why do we stay?  Because, in “For Good,” we remind our recovering friend it is not our heroism, but hers. Her presence in our lives has been for good; we are here for good.

To those of you full of the loving intentionality that gives you the strength to stand, and to those for whom you stand, I offer the lyrics and the YouTube links to each of these songs.  Read along and take in the spirit of each. If you can, do it together.  It is my belief that it will remind you each of the courage you show each and every day of recovery.  It is my hope that it will stir in you the grace to carry on together to the end of the recovery journey.
